    Notes: New Processable polyaromatic ether-keto-sulfones were prepared from the acid chloride of bis-m-carboxyphenyl acetylene (XII), isophthaloyl chloride (XX), diphenyl ether (XVIII), and 4,4′-diphenoxydiphenyl sulfone (XIX) in a Friedel-Crafts-type polymerization. These polymers were cured by Diels-Alder cycloaddition with 1,4-diphenyl-1,3-butadiene. The cured polymers showed an increase in Tg and in thermal and heat stabilities. The polymers form colorless, transparent, brittle films and can be cast into a glass fiber laminate. Both meta-and para-substituted acid chlorides of biscarboxyphenyl-1,3-butadiene yielded insoluble polymers under the same conditions but form processable polymers where combined with acetylene units in the polymer chain. Polymers that contained both acetylene and butadiene units were prepared but could not be cured by an intramolecular Diels-Alder cycloaddition reaction.
